TV SHOW OF THE DAY: The School (RTE 2, 10.35)
The latest comedy series to begin airing on RTE, The School is a mockumentary style show about a dysfunctional Irish primary school.
Dominic English is the straight-laced new principal at St. Colmcilles Primary School who intends to "whip the school into shape" ahead of its annual nativity play. As the first "outsider" to be appointed to this role however, he is forced to acclimatise to a strange school and an even stranger staff. First, being made unaware that a documentary is being made, he must also deal with secretary Briege Daly, who has decided he will make the perfect husband, while a jealous and arrogant teacher, Mr. Hegarty seeks to intimidate and undermine him constantly.
The School was created by CCCahoots, a Cork-based comedy troupe whose previous work includes the RTE Storyland web series (R)onanism. It also marks a new shift in how RTE is attempting to broadcast original content, as it was the first series to be made available online last Friday (17th November) ahead of the televised release.
The School airs tonight on RTE 2 at 10.35pm.
